Analysis

The most recent figure for outbound internationally mobile tertiary students studying in central in GPE: South Asia Wb Fy24, December 2024 is 13,377,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 27 years on record.

That represents a change of up 18.7% on the previous year and up 714.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, outbound internationally mobile tertiary students studying in central in GPE: South Asia Wb Fy24, December 2024 peaked at 13,377 in 2023 and was at its lowest, 331, in 1997.

GPE: South Asia Wb Fy24, December 2024 ranks 65th of 221 groups on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
